Notes

If you have already programmed the Áor ¤button of each component any signals by “learning”, the procedure above will not change the function of the Áand ¤buttons.

If you have programmed volume control signals on Áor ¤buttons of TV or AMP by the “learning” function (page 12), you can only use that signal when you select TV or AMP. For other component, the preset volume control signals for TV or AMP (depending on the above setting procedure) will be transmitted. To use the new signals, you need to program each button for each component by the learning procedure (page 12).

Executing a Series of Commands

— System Control Function

With the System Control function, you can program a series of operating commands, and execute them by pressing just one button.

For example, when you watch a video, a series of operations like the ones below are necessary.

Example:

1Power on the TV.

2Power on the video (VCR 1).

3Power on the amplifier.

4Set the imput selector of the amplifier to VIDEO 1.

5Set the input mode of the TV to

VIDEO.

6Start video playback.

You can program up to 16 consecutive operation steps to each of the SYSTEM CONTROL 1, 2 or 3. At the factory, SYSTEM CONTROL 1 and 2 are not programmed yet, but a series of Power- on Commands for Sony Components is programmed on the SYSTEM CONTROL 3 button.
